I thought
One Fell Swoop was a step up from
Sunsets & Car Crashes. Since then they released
No Really, I'm Fine which offered five previously unreleased tracks - one "remix," two covers, an acoustic song, and a hard song. I think "To Live Without It" was the only standout track. I know some who think the EP version of "Appreciation and the Bomb" turned out to be better than the
No Really, I'm Fine version- I disagree.
I can't give valid reasons why
No Really, I'm Fine didn't live up to my expectations. I thought the single "All Over You" was amazingly catchy and sure to put them on the (MTV) map. I thought "Hush Hush" and "Bleed, Everyone's Doing It" were two other stand-out tracks. For some reason this album just wasn't on the same level as
One Fell Swoop for me. It could have been that I was able to connect with the latter because that album was my soundtrack to graduating high school and moving out whereas the former was just another album. Either way, I've been a fan of TSC for years and I'm not about to count them out. I hope they deliver their best with this EP and whatever else follows.
